O que é VACÂNCIA DO CARGO PÚBLICO?
Summary
TLDRIn this video, Anderson Patrocínio explains the concept of 'vacância' in public office, which refers to the vacancy or unoccupied status of a public position. He outlines the legal requirements for holding a public office and the various reasons for a vacancy, including resignation, dismissal, promotion, retirement, death, and taking on an incompatible position. Takeaways
- 😀 A public position must be filled through a public exam, appointment, and taking office.
- 😀 Vacância refers to the vacancy of a public position, meaning it is no longer occupied by the previous employee.
- 😀 Vacância can occur due to various reasons such as exoneration, demotion, promotion, and retirement.
- 😀 Exoneration can happen at the employee's request or by official order for reasons such as unsatisfactory performance or probation failure.
- 😀 Demotion occurs as a disciplinary action for misconduct or crimes against public administration, such as abandonment of position.
- 😀 Promotion leads to an employee moving to a higher position, leaving their previous position vacant.
- 😀 Readjustment is when an employee is reassigned to a role that matches their physical capacity after a medical condition.
- 😀 Retirement can occur voluntarily, or due to age or disability, resulting in the vacancy of the position.
- 😀 Taking another incompatible position can lead to the vacancy of the initial role.
- 😀 The death of an employee causes the vacância of their public position.

Q & A
What is the main topic of the video?
-The main topic of the video is the concept of 'vacância' in public office positions, which refers to the situation when a public position becomes unoccupied or vacant.
What does the term 'vacância' mean in the context of public offices?
-'Vacância' refers to the situation when a public position, previously occupied by a public servant, becomes unoccupied. This can occur for various reasons such as resignation, dismissal, or promotion.
What are the prerequisites for someone to occupy a public office in Brazil?
-In Brazil, a person must be approved in a public competition (exam), be appointed to the position, and take possession of the role to occupy a public office.
What is the legal framework governing public servants in Brazil?
-The legal framework governing public servants in Brazil is Law 8.112/90, which defines the legal regime for civil servants of the Union, its agencies, and federal public foundations.
What are some reasons for the vacancy of a public office?
-A public office can become vacant due to reasons such as resignation, dismissal, promotion, retirement, death, or appointment to another incompatible position.
What is the process of 'exoneração' (resignation) in a public office?
-Exoneração (resignation) occurs either at the request of the public servant or by official action. It can happen when a servant does not wish to continue their duties or fails to meet probationary conditions.
What is the role of a probationary period in the vacancy of a public office?
-A public servant who does not meet the conditions during their probationary period or fails to assume their duties within the established timeframe can have their position vacated through resignation.
How does 'promoção' (promotion) affect the vacancy of a public office?
-Promotion results in a public servant assuming a higher hierarchical position, leaving their previous position vacant as they move to the new role.
Can a public servant's position be vacated due to medical reasons?
-Yes, a public servant's position can be vacated due to a medical condition through 'readaptação,' which involves reassignment to a position with duties compatible with their physical capabilities.
What happens when a public servant retires?
-Retirement marks the end of a public servant’s career. It can be voluntary, due to physical incapacity, or compulsory. This leads to the vacancy of the position.
What happens if a public servant dies while in office?
-The death of a public servant automatically results in the vacancy of their position.
